Dear Zoo

Author Rod Campbell’s best-selling classic children’s lift-the-flaps book Dear Zoo is being brought to life for the very first time in 2018 with a brilliant new stage production. The book was first published in 1982 and has sold more than 8 million copies worldwide and the new production is kicking off a huge UK tour, landing at Theatre Royal Bury St Edmunds Sat 17 and Sun 18 Feb.

Celebrating 35 years in 2017, Dear Zoo is the story of a child who writes to the zoo asking them to send a pet. Brought to life through child-engaging puppets, original music and lots of audience interaction, the show will immediately appeal to families and children who already love the book as well as serving as a wonderful introduction to those coming to the story for the first time.

Rod Campbell is the master of interactive storytelling and an expert in early learning for pre-schoolers. As a trusted household name, his books have stood the test of time and continue to be a staple addition to the family bookshelf and a popular choice for early years’ teachers. The author of more than 200 books for children, Rod Campbell’s unique ability to be both fun and reassuring encourages children to discover and delight in the world around them.
